About Me

Hi, I’m Doctor Alex, a UK-trained doctor with six years of experience working in Medical and Emergency departments across the UK and Australia. I also work as an Expedition Medic, supporting teams in some of the most remote and challenging environments on the planet, from dense jungles to high-altitude treks

Working in these settings has taught me how to act fast, stay calm, and make decisions under pressure. In the wilderness, accidents and emergencies can strike at any time. But back in hospitals, it was a different story: most patients weren’t there because of sudden accidents — they were struggling with chronic diseases. Amazingly, around 70% of these conditions are preventable worldwide.

Most chronic health problems don’t appear overnight, and they don’t disappear with quick fixes or a handful of pills. That’s why I now specialise in lifestyle medicine.

Lifestyle medicine is an evidence-based approach that uses sustainable behavioural changes to prevent, manage, and even reverse chronic disease.​ Yet despite its potential, lifestyle medicine isn’t fully integrated into everyday healthcare. I believe it’s an approach that should underpin every branch of medicine, from emergency care to family practice.

 

After years in emergency medicine, I realised that while I could treat crises, the greatest impact comes from preventing problems before they reach the hospital. That’s why I’m planning to train as a GP, where I can work closely with people over time, help them make lasting changes, and bring this focus on prevention and long-term health into everyday medical care.
